powerpc: Replace _ALIGN_DOWN() by ALIGN_DOWN()

_ALIGN_DOWN() is specific to powerpc
ALIGN_DOWN() is generic and does the same

Replace _ALIGN_DOWN() by ALIGN_DOWN()
